Stone on sale
The sale, organised by ex-wife Jo, features artwork, Stones stage outfits and one of Wood's prized Fender guitars, but Ronnie clearly wasn't consulted, saying he's "staggered" and "shocked" by the sale, which is expected to raise up to half a million dollars for Grammy charity MusiCares.
A statement from Wood's representatives reads "Ronnie feels saddened that Jo has taken this course of action and wants the public to know he has not teamed up with Jo on this outrageous sale."

Artist Biography
Ronald David "Ronnie" Wood (born 1 June 1947) is an English rock musician best known as a former member of the Jeff Beck Group, Faces, and a member of the Rolling Stones since 1975. Wood began his career in 1964, when he joined The Birds on guitar.
